The global Ground Fault Analyzers and Detectors Market size was valued at approximately USD 1.3 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 2.7 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 7.2% during the forecast period.
The Ground Fault Analyzers and Detectors Market involves devices and systems designed to detect and analyze ground faults in electrical systems, enhancing safety and operational efficiency. This market encompasses a range of products that include handheld devices, fixed installations, and integrated systems used across residential, commercial, and industrial sectors. These analyzers are crucial for preventing electrical hazards and ensuring compliance with safety regulations.
The industry is in a growth phase fueled by increasing safety standards, the expansion of electrical grids, and the ongoing industrial automation trend. Shifts towards smart grids and the integration of IoT are further transforming the product landscape. The industry outlook remains positive as innovations continue to reduce the complexity and cost of implementation, broadening the market reach and adoption.

North America leads the pack in market share, propelled by advanced infrastructure and early adoption of the latest safety technologies. The region benefits from a highly mature market, with constant innovation keeping local companies competitive. In Europe, strict regulatory measures coupled with a strong focus on sustainability drive market traction. Conversely, the Asia Pacific region shows immense growth potential due to rapid industrialization and increasing adoption of modern safety practices, supported by government initiatives. Latin America presents emerging opportunities driven by developmental projects, whereas the Middle East & Africa are slowly evolving, representing nascent market potential.
The global market offers a mix of consolidated and fragmented elements, with notable companies maintaining a strong foothold through continuous innovation. Key players in the market such as Schneider Electric, Littelfuse, and Bender GmbH hold significant shares, leveraging diversified product portfolios and global presence.
